Sensitive Information Exposure in Chapa Payment Gateway for WooCommerce by WordPress
CVE-2025-15482

5.3MEDIUM

What is CVE-2025-15482?

The Chapa Payment Gateway Plugin for WooCommerce has a vulnerability that allows unauthenticated attackers to access sensitive data via the 'chapa_proceed' API endpoint. This flaw could result in the leakage of critical information, including the merchant's Chapa secret API key, enabling potential exploitation and compromise of payment-related data.

Affected Version(s)

Chapa Payment Gateway Plugin for WooCommerce * <= 1.0.3
